I have a 2011 E, I'm 5'11". I fit on my bed almost exactly between the tail gate and the front seats, but it wasn't super comfortable. I needed to make the front seats tilt forward, i just needed a few more inches. If you take off the side covers on the seats. You will see there is a stop for the seats, one on each side. If you cut those off with a grinder or Dremel, the seats will then tilt forward. It gives you about 6 inches more space, it made it way more comfortable.

Hey Nate, this is in regards to setting up the mattress at 7:50. I'm in the process of shopping around for an Element. You stated that you couldn't fold the seats forward. Is that still the case? I need the seats to fold forward and use the area that you ended up passing up. Do you happen to know the Elements that have the front seats folding forward? Really odd that Honda would make it where they don't fold forward anymore.
@ElementLife
2 жыл бұрын
The second generation Elements (I believe 2007 and later) have the seatbelt built into the front seats. It used to be on the door in the first generation. When they added this feature they also added a stopper piece which prevents the seats from folding all the way forward. Apparently it is pretty easy to remove this as it's only a small piece of metal behind the plastic cover trim on the lower part of the seats. I haven't tried removing it yet on our Element.
